VOORHEES v. GLENWAL CO., INC.


77 N.J. Super. 65 (1962)

185 A.2d 401

ROBERT VOORHEES, PETITIONER-RESPONDENT, v. GLENWAL CO., INC., RESPONDENT-APPELLANT.

Superior Court of New Jersey, Appellate Division.

Decided November 8, 1962.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Mr. Isidor Kalisch, attorney for appellant.

Messrs. Mandel, Wysoker, Sherman & Glassner, attorneys for respondent (Mr. Jack Wysoker, on the brief).

Before Judges GOLDMANN, FREUND and FOLEY.


The opinion of the court was delivered by GOLDMANN, S.J.A.D.

Respondent company appeals from an interlocutory order of the Workmen's Compensation Division, pursuant to leave granted.

The claim petition sought compensation for an injury suffered by petitioner while in respondent's employ on June 15, 1961, when he was struck on the left side of his head by a wrecking bar. Following the filing of an answer in which respondent company admitted a compensable incident...
